Benefits of using Artificial Plants
Artificial Plants are just as beautiful and good looking as their real versions except that these ones don’t need constant eye on them. We are going to look at some of the upside to decorating with Artificial Plants. They include;
Little to No Maintenance
As said earlier, one major benefit of faux plants is the fact that they require very minimal care, Maintenance and attention. In fact the best way to keep artificial plants in good condition is not paying too much attention to them
Zero worries about seasons
If you lead q hectic life, then it is very wise to consider Faux plants because these ones do not require to take note of any special date or whatever. You don’t need to worry about Summer or Winter or Raining season, nothing! You can enjoy your plants throughout the year without fear or worry about weather conditions.
Improves your home
Sometimes, people just love to be around nature thus, adding faux plants to your home just might make them a lot more comfortable. Also the presence of nice Plants have proven to be able to improve an individual both psychologically and otherwise.
Very Affordable
Fake plants are a lot cheaper than real ones and you don’t have to worry about maintaining them
Wider Variety
Fake plants come in different Types and forms which makes it a lot easier for them to match your existing décor. You can also get creative with them.
Disadvantages of using Faux plants
No Growth
You can never make a Faux plant grow no matter how hard you try. This means if for some reason, your preference changes over the years, you just have to purchase another.
They look cheap
Depending on where you purchase it, sometimes faux plants look poorly made and unrealistic. Times like this, you will feel like you wasted your money.
Types of Artificial Plants
If you need ideas on how to fit in artificial plants into your home decoration or you just want to fool some overconfident horticulturists, check out this list of plants and trees that don’t look fake at all;
BANANA LEAF PALM
This particular plant can easily be gotten at Target for about $30. It gives one the feeling of a lazy day spent on the beach. The Banana leaf palm have very real looking fronds that shoots out of a ceramic pot. This plant is perfect for creating a calm, tropical vibe.
FIDDLE-LEAF FIG PLANT
Everything about this plant is just dramatic. Its wide leaves and thin branches gives the fiddle-leaf fig plant an even more dramatic and sculptural look that lightens up any corner it is placed. However, the faux version of this plant gives you room to style its branches however you like. This plant can be easily gotten at World Market for $130.
POTTED RUBBER TREE
Normally, Rubber trees have dark leafs that if not properly cared for with adequate sunlight can fade to lighter Green. However the faux version of this plant is a lot easier to maintain. It doesn’t need sunlight or too much attention, it won’t fade from lacked of sunlight. This version can be gotten for $65 at West Elm.
FICUS
This plant is some kind of fig tree, 4 feet tall from its pot. The Ficus is arguably one of the best faux plants to keep because it doesn’t really require so much care. Some people call it “the one plant that would never die on you”. It is sold at Joss & Main for $220.
REX BEGONIA
The faux version of this plant has a very realistic looking heart shaped leaf, a purple pop of color as well as a ceramic pot. It doesn’t need any care as it offers all the dramatic color and texture the original version normally would. Getting the faux version is advised because while the real Rex Begonia is very demanding when it comes to care, the faux version is less stressful. This version of plant is sold at The Sill for $75. The Rex Begonia is perfect for a bookshelf.
ALOCASIAS
Alocasias, popularly known as Elephant Ears as a result of their broad leafs resembling the animal’s ears. Just like the fiddle-leaf fig plant, this plant is also dramatic and could put some of that drama in just any room or empty space. It is also sold at World Market at a price of $300. Honestly, it is funny how this plant doubles as a décor
WHITE CHEERY BLOSSOM BRANCH
These plants are usually best during springtime. They are in vogue all year round. Cherry blossoms are quite dramatic and its fluffy white bottoms add texture to your home. The beautiful thing about these plants is that they can be placed anywhere…. Even in the kitchen! It is sold for about $36 and can be purchased at Target.
HANGING POTHOS
A Pop of Green usually makes any room come alive whether or not it is real. Just like the name implies, this kinds of plants look their best when they are suspended in front of your bedroom window in a woven planter. You can also tuck it above your upper cabinets just to draw a person’s attention that high up.
